Key Insights of Japan T-BOX Backup Battery Market

  • Market size estimated at approximately USD 1.2 billion in 2023, with robust growth driven by automotive electrification and IoT integration.
  • Projected CAGR of 12.5% from 2026 to 2033, reflecting accelerating adoption across automotive, industrial, and consumer electronics sectors.
  • Dominant segment: Lithium-ion batteries, favored for their high energy density and longevity, accounting for over 75% of market share.
  • Primary application: Vehicle telematics and safety systems, with increasing integration in electric and hybrid vehicles.
  • Leading geographic region: Japan’s domestic market, with expanding export opportunities in Asia-Pacific and North America.
  • Key market opportunity: Rising demand for smart, compact backup solutions tailored for autonomous vehicles and smart infrastructure.
  • Major players: Panasonic, Sony, Murata Manufacturing, and Toshiba, leveraging their technological expertise and extensive distribution networks.

Market Scope and Industry Classification of Japan T-BOX Backup Battery Sector

The Japan T-BOX backup battery market operates within the broader automotive components and industrial power storage industry, characterized by rapid innovation and high regulatory standards. This sector primarily serves automotive manufacturers, Tier-1 suppliers, and electronics integrators, focusing on delivering reliable, compact, and durable backup power solutions. The industry classification aligns with global standards such as NAICS 335911 (Storage Battery Manufacturing) and IHS Markit’s automotive component categories, emphasizing advanced battery technologies and embedded power systems.

Regionally, Japan’s market is both mature and innovative, driven by strict safety regulations, environmental policies, and a strong automotive export sector. The scope extends to emerging applications like autonomous driving, smart city infrastructure, and industrial automation, where backup batteries are vital for ensuring uninterrupted operation and safety. The market’s evolution reflects a transition from traditional lead-acid solutions to high-performance lithium-ion and solid-state batteries, positioning Japan as a leader in next-generation backup power technologies.

SWOT Analysis of Japan T-BOX Backup Battery Market

  • Strengths: Advanced technological capabilities, strong R&D ecosystem, high safety standards, and established supply chains.
  • Weaknesses: High manufacturing costs, dependency on imported raw materials, and relatively slow adoption in smaller markets.
  • Opportunities: Growing EV market, smart city initiatives, and export potential in Asia-Pacific and North America.
  • Threats: Supply chain disruptions, raw material price volatility, and intense global competition from Chinese and Korean manufacturers.
